New Golden Bachelor Teaser Proves Gerry Turner Is “Aged to Perfection”

Gerry Turner is ready to handout some roses.
As the 71-year-old embarks on his journey of love in the inaugural season of the Golden Bachelor, he can't help but note how far out of his comfort zone he's headed in the ABC dating show's new teaser.
"I don't always date 20 women at once," Gerry says in the July 26 clip. "But I'm about to."
While the clip doesn't give too much away from the upcoming season—those vying for the retired restaurateur's heart have yet to be revealed—the series has proven its leaning into its "golden" theme. After all, the clip features shots of a luxurious cheese board can be seen along with fine wine and a vintage car—all of which are known for being enhanced with time.
"It's been said that some things get better with age—experience that is valued; a taste that only gets more refined," the video's narrator is heard saying as Gerry dusts off a bottle of wine. "In life, good things take time and this love story is worth the wait."
And in addition to trading in young love for a second shot, the clip also shows the iconic red Bachelor rose transformed into a golden rose.
The teaser comes just weeks after it was announced that Gerry would be the leading man in the latest spinoff in the franchise. As for why the Indiana native—who was married to his high school sweetheart Toni for 43 years, until her death in 2017—is ready for his journey?
As he told Good Morning America July 17, it's "because it's never too late to fall in love again."
"I think my thoughts always go to the way I've done things," he continued. "Don't give up. There's always possibilities."
Gerry also took a moment to reflect on what his late wife would think of his search for love.
"I have her picture on a dresser in my closet," he shared. "And every morning I give her the nod, 'So what do you think about this?' For a while I was having a hard time figuring out if she would be okay."
The Golden Bachelor is set to hit ABC this fall. In the meantime, click here to learn everything there is to know about Gerry.
